Mediaeval tiles
This work was a cross curricular project done by Year 7 pupils at Dingleside Middle School, Redditch as part of their work in Art and History. A visit to Forge Mill Museum in Redditch gave the pupils an opportunity to observe and draw some mediaeval tiles from observation. These tiles were made by the Cistercian monks from Bordesley Abbey. Sketches were developed into symmetrical designs using the computer. The resulting print outs were interpreted using traditional techniques in the Art lessons with Sian Kibblewhite.
